Jalapeño Popper Grilled Cheese

I really like jalapeño poppers, and I really like grilled cheese, voila. It's a bit on the spicy side so beware.

Ingredients

Crusty bread, such as a country French or sourdough
1 block cream cheese
Jalapeños (1 per sandwich)
Pepper jack cheese
Butter

Roast jalapeños on grill, under broiler, or on stove top until skin is blackened. Then place in plastic or paper bag until cool enough to handle. Remove the skin, then cut open and remove the seeds and membranes. Cut into strips. Beware, oh beware, wash your hands after this step!

Spread butter on outsides of bread, then spread a thinnish layer of cream cheese on the inside, layer with jalapeño strips and then a layer of pepper jack cheese.

Grill. Then let cool a couple of minutes before eating.
